Project Summary

Norad's Enterprise Development for Jobs (EDFJ) grant scheme supports private sector development in developing countries by providing grants to reduce investment risks, including support for feasibility studies, partner searches, and training of local employees

The objective of the study was to assess two specific aspects of the EDFJ grant scheme relating efficiency and quality of its operations in addition to efficiency and quality of the grant scheme design.
